NYSE Euronext And Borsa Italiana Announce The Signing Of An Agreement For The Sale Of NYSE Euronext’s Stake In MBE Holding
Date 03/08/2007
NYSE Euronext (NYSE Euronext: NYX) and Borsa Italiana have signed an agreement regarding MBE Holding, their joint venture that owns 60.37% of Società per il Mercato dei Titoli di Stato S.p.A. (“MTS”), and MTSNext. Under the terms of the agreement, NYSE Euronext’s 51% stake in MBE Holding and 33% stake in MTSNext are valued at €100 million (dividend attached).

FINRA Announces Interim Board Of Governors To Serve Until Annual Meeting For Board Elections - Elections For Three-Year Transition Board To Be Conducted On October 26
Date 02/08/2007
The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(FINRA) today announced the members of its 23-member Interim Board of Governors, who will serve until FINRA's three-year Transition Board of Governors is elected at an Annual Meeting on October 26.

U.S. Futures Exchange To Exclusively List Futures On Select Lehman Brothers’ Fixed Income Benchmark Indexes
Date 02/08/2007
U.S. Futures Exchange (USFE) announced today that it has signed a licensing agreement with Lehman Brothers to list cash-settled futures contracts derived from Lehman Brothers’ U.S. Treasury Index, U.S. Corporate High-Yield Index, U.S. Credit 7-10 Year Index and U.S. Treasury 7-10 Year Index. Futures on the Corporate High-Yield, U.S. Credit 7-10 Year, and U.S. Treasury 7-10 Year indices will be available exclusively on USFE’s all-electronic trading platform.

NYMEX Holdings Declares Quarterly Dividend
Date 02/08/2007
NYMEX Holdings, Inc.(NYSE:NMX), the parent company of the New York Mercantile Exchange, Inc., has declared a quarterly dividend of 10 cents per share to shareholders of record as of September 4, 2007, payable on September 28, 2007.

Minneapolis Grain Exchange Membership Sets Another Record With A Sale At $230,000
Date 02/08/2007
Just after the Minneapolis Grain Exchange (MGEX or Exchange) announced a record membership sale at $215,000 yesterday, three more sales occurred driving the record price to $230,000.

BOX Sets Trading Volume Records In July 2007, Price Improvement Also At Record Rate
Date 02/08/2007
The month of July 2007 proved to be the best month in Boston Options Exchange’s (“BOX”) history, witnessing new daily, weekly, and monthly volume records as follows: Best single day in BOX history: July 26, with 1,223,666 contracts executed. First time BOX surpasses the 1 million mark. Best week in BOX history: July 23 through 27, with an average daily volume of 882,400 contracts executed. Best month in BOX history: July, with an average daily volume of 636,550 contracts
